My 1st day of fitness boot camp:

I am not sure if everyone knows this, but I strive to stay in shape, not because I am one of those no shirt or tight shirt-wearing brothers (Perfect example of this is TO. I know women love watching his reality show), but just because I am probably predisposed to certain chronic health conditions (e.g., high blood pressure & diabetes) due to the genes passed onto me by my parents. Therefore, I have been trying to be proactive by exercising and implementing a sound and balanced diet.

 

My exercise routine (when I actually make it into the gym LOL) consists of weight training and cardio. I wanted to increase the amount of cardio I was doing on a weekly basis, so I implemented a circuit training routine, which includes weight training, cardio, and core exercises. On the days I am not weight training, I try to do about 45 minutes of cardio, but I have not been very inspired lately. That is why I decided to try out a “Jumpstart” Outdoor Workout brought to you by Certified Personal Trainer Alita Brown. She owns a personal training studio called Fitness Together in the Capitol Hill area of Washington, DC.  She is a fellow alumnus of Florida A&M University (located on the highest of seven hills in Tallahassee, FL founded in 1887). Forgive me for digressing but I always feel the need to give a shout out to my beloved alma mater.

 

Considering that Alita is a friend of mind, and I try to support friends in all of their endeavors, I decided to sign up for one of her Jumpstart Outdoor Workout Sessions. I knew that the training session probably consisted of a grueling nonstop cardio vascular workout that included everything from light jogging and sprinting to different type of exercises to strengthen my core muscles. What I was not prepared for, which I do not think anyone is unless they have been participating in these types of rigorous training curriculums, was the intensity and exhaustion my body would undertake. During the workout, I would have to admit that I was not a happy camper. I did not want to high, five much less talk to the trainers, because I was tired and wondering what possessed me to sign up for this torture. At the end of the session I my body was fully exhausted, I was drenched in sweat from head to toe, and I was still why I had subjected myself to this workout (It could not be friendship. Friendship p has its limitations LOL). At the end of the day, I felt it was worth it. I had not felt that exhausted after a workout since my days of wrestling back in High School (Thanks Coach Moore). By combining a cardio workout like that with my weight training, I feel that I will be able keep myself in great shape, considering I enjoy cooking and eating.
